
Oriental Shorthair
The Oriental Shorthair is a breed of domestic cat that is closely related to the Siamese. It maintains the modern Siamese head and body type but appears in a wide range of coat colors and patterns.

π Personality & Behavior
Social, intelligent, and vocal. They attach intensely to their people and can be demanding.
π Food & Treats
High-quality diet to maintain lean muscle mass. Dental health is important.

High interaction needs. Bored Orientals can be destructive or noisy.
π‘ Living Environment
Ideally indoor living. They are sensitive to cold and need companionship.
